
Swiss Battery Days 2020/2021
The Swiss Battery Days provides young researchers, active in the field of battery materials and cell manufacturing, a platform to present their results and to connect to renowned battery researchers from Europe. The conference will be held online on 15-17 Febreary 2021.
The event offers a unique opportunity to strengthen and expand the network among and to the Swiss battery community. The Industry Day afternoon is organised by the Swiss national platform for battery industry and research partners – iBAT. The scope of the event ranges from the synthesis and characterisation of battery materials to their integration into electrodes and cells, including topics related to cell manufacturing and characterisation.
